History

Established in 1972, Mount Vernon Presbyterian School serves students in Preschool through twelfth grade and is located in the heart of Sandy Springs within the metropolitan Atlanta area on a 37 acre campus. In 2008, MVPS celebrated the first graduating class of the School. The academic year 2007-08 marked the first year to offer a comprehensive AP program. In 2008-09, Honors courses were added; Seven (7) points were added to AP courses, and three (3) points were added to Honors courses, with the total semester grade not exceeding 100 points. Students enrolled in an AP course are required to take the AP exam at the end of the semester.
